Psalms 7:1 In-Context
1
<
> Yahweh, my God, I take refuge in you. Save me from all those who pursue me, and deliver me,
2
Lest they tear apart my soul like a lion, Rending it in pieces, while there is none to deliver.
3
Yahweh, my God, if I have done this, If there is iniquity in my hands,
4
If I have rewarded evil to him who was at peace with me (Yes, I have delivered him who without cause was my adversary),
5
Let the enemy pursue my soul, and overtake it; Yes, let him tread my life down to the earth, And lay my glory in the dust. Selah.
